Limited Liability Protection

One of the most important benefits of forming an LLC is personal asset protection. In Illinois, LLC members are not personally liable for the debts or legal obligations of the business. This means your personal assets, such as your home, car, and savings, are generally shielded from lawsuits or creditor claims against the company.

This protection is similar to what corporations offer but with fewer formalities, making LLCs a preferred choice for small businesses and startups.

Flexible Tax Options

Illinois LLCs enjoy pass-through taxation by default. This means the business itself does not pay federal income taxes. Instead, profits and losses are passed through to the members, who report them on their personal tax returns. This avoids the double taxation that corporations often face.

Additionally, LLCs in Illinois can elect to be taxed as:

  • Sole proprietorships (for single-member LLCs)
  • Partnerships (for multi-member LLCs)
  • S corporations or C corporations (if elected with the IRS)

This flexibility allows business owners to choose the tax structure that best fits their financial goals and operational needs.

Affordable Formation and Maintenance Costs

Illinois offers competitive pricing for LLC formation. The filing fee for Articles of Organization is $150, and the annual report fee is $75. Many of the other filing costs are also affordable as compared to other states. Illinois provides a cost-effective entry point for new businesses.

This affordability extends to ongoing compliance, making it easier for small business owners to maintain their LLC status without excessive administrative burden.

Simplified Management Structure

Unlike corporations, LLCs are not required to have a board of directors, hold annual meetings, or maintain extensive records. In Illinois, LLCs can be managed by members or designated managers, depending on the operating agreement.

This flexibility allows business owners to focus on operations rather than corporate formalities. It also makes LLCs ideal for family businesses, freelancers, and partnerships seeking a streamlined structure.

Series LLC Option

Illinois is one of the few states that allows the formation of a Series LLC. This unique structure lets business owners create multiple “series” under one parent LLC, each with its own assets, liabilities, and operations.

Benefits of a Series LLC include:

  • Separate liability protection for each series
  • Simplified registration and reporting
  • Cost savings compared to forming multiple LLCs

This is especially useful for real estate investors, franchise owners, or entrepreneurs managing multiple ventures.

Privacy and Credibility

Forming an LLC adds credibility to your business. Clients, vendors, and investors often view LLCs as more professional and trustworthy than sole proprietorships. In Illinois, you can also use a registered agent to maintain privacy, keeping your personal address off public records.
